This week Barbadians remember and salute the life and times of late Prime Minister and National Hero Errol Walton Barrow.
Tomorrow evening deputy principal of the Cave Hill Campus of the University of the West Indies, Professor Eudine Barriteau, delivers the annual memorial lecture at the Frank Collymore Hall, and Prime Minister Freundel Stuart presents the lunchtime lecture at the Democratic Labour Party’s headquarters, George Street, on Friday.
The activities conclude on Saturday, Errol Barrow Day, a public holiday.
